What can Pofily offer?

Show filters of Pofily – WooCommerce Product Filters in Modal

Users can decide whether to show WooCommerce product filters in the modal window or not. If you disable this feature, the filters appear on the sidebar of the widget. If enabled, users can customize the modal appearance to match their expectations, with various available customizing options.

  • Show product filters in the Modal window with an Off-canvas style or Top product loop style
  • Manage the position and the style of the Modal icon with Icon position and Modal icon style
  • Change the position, effect, and column layout of the Modal
  • Choose a style: Theme style or Custom style
  • Style the filter area with the color of the Title, Background, and Accent color
  • Set a default color for the Color swatches type (Taxonomy)
  • Customize label with default, hovered, and active status: font size, border width, border radius, background color, text color

Create filters using Pofily – WooCommerce Product Filters to facilitate convenient product searches for customers.

Administrators can generate various WooCommerce product filters catering to different search requirements according to customer preferences. Each product filter offers customizable design options and can be modified. Users can also produce multiple versions with the same filter type.

  • Create multiple filter blocks for particular searching purposes with different options: Taxonomy, Price, Review, OnSale/In stock, Name, Metabox.
  • Choose Taxonomy to apply the filter: Categories, Product tags, Attribute (Color, Size,…), …
  • Show Filter as checkboxes, buttons, color swatches, images, ranges, range slider, search field (with Name)
  • Customize terms or values with labels to replace the original name.
  • Customize terms/values with a tooltip when hovering the mouse over the term/value.
  • Show/hide the name of the terms
  • Customize the range with Min and Max values.
  • Create as many ranges as you want with Range type.
  • Create a range slider with a Min – Max value and a Step Slider.
  • Enable/Disable to show filter as a toggle
  • Enable/Disable to show the number of items.
  • Enable/Disable to allow customers to choose multiple selections.
  • Enable/Disable to show the “View more” button.
  • Enable/Disable to show the “Clear” button.
  • Select Order by Name, Slug, or ID and choose Order type between ASC or DESC (for Taxonomy)
  • Select the “Display type” – Vertical or Horizontal – for the Button type
  • With Filter By Metadata, we provide meta keys of Products available in the database. Manage the settings and the plugin will display the corresponding metavalue

Customize and arrange front-end menus using Pofily – WooCommerce Product Filters.

Generate menus to showcase WooCommerce product filters, adding numerous filters as needed, and establishing regulations to determine their display areas. For instance, you can configure a rule to exhibit the initial menu on the Shop Page and set the second menu to only appear within a specific category or tag. Therefore, when customers visit the Shop page, the first menu will be visible, and upon selecting that designated category/tag, the second menu will be displayed. Both menus can contain the same filters.

  • Choose and add blocks you want the menu to display on your website with created blocks
  • Drag and drop to change the position of the Filter that appeared in the menu.
  • Set rules to display the Filter Menu at Display Conditions
  • Enable/Disable to show the “Apply Filter” button
  • Enable/Disable to show menu in a modal window

Pofily – WooCommerce Product Filters supports displaying Filter Menus using shortcodes

We offer a shortcode option when creating a Filter Menu. This shortcode allows you to display the Filter Menu in the desired location to suit your requirements. Simply copy the shortcode and paste it into the preferred location.
